The Ultimate Sashiko Card Deck: The Perfect Way to Learn This Traditional Japanese Needlework Technique
Sashiko is a traditional Japanese needlework technique that uses simple running stitch to create beautiful decorative patterns. It is a relatively easy technique to learn, but it can be challenging to master.
